Dagget Hollow & Redbud Lane via Sam Vadalabene Bike Trail is a 5.6-mile out-and-back in Pere Marquette State Park near Marshall Landing, IL. The route reaches Dagget Hollow at the turnaround, 2.8 miles in. It climbs 377 ft, with sections as steep as 22% grade, and is mostly paved. It scores 7/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: paved and peopled.

  1. Start at the trailhead, heading NW.
  2. 300 ftSharp right onto Sam Vadalabene Bike Trail, heading SE.
  3. 2 miContinue straight onto Redbud Lane, heading E.
  4. 0.7 miReach Dagget Hollow, then turn around and head back the way you came.
  5. 0.7 miContinue straight onto Sam Vadalabene Bike Trail, heading W.
  6. 2 miSharp left, heading NW.
  7. 50 ftArrive back at the trailhead.
